Product snapshot
Annie's Organic Dijon Mustard comes in a 9 oz jar and is marketed as gluten-free and organic. The ingredient list highlights distilled white vinegar, water, mustard seeds, sea salt, and clove, with all components indicated as organic on the label. The product carries a strong consumer rating (4.3/5 from 3,093 reviews) and is commonly purchased for everyday condiments and sandwich applications.

Gluten safety and certifications
The product is labeled gluten-free and lists gluten-free ingredients. There are no explicit third-party gluten-free certifications (such as GFCO/NSF) stated on the packaging. Cross-contact labeling is not specified on the provided data, which means there is no documented may-contain or facility-cross-contact language in the supplied information. Overall, the gluten safety assessment supports a likely-safe profile for those avoiding gluten, though it is not certified by a third party on the label.
